The main project’s goal is to go

beyond a traditional idea of building.

The area is located in the

beautiful country of Tuscany, very

closed to the city center of Florence,

surrounded by many olive trees

and bordered on the north side

by a stream.

The project borns around the idea

of creating houses completely integrated

with the landscape, done

by a concrete walls structure and

a green roof, able to re-build the

original terrain shape, traditionally

cultivated with vineyards or olive

trees.

Every house has a patio, created

to give a peculiar light to the living

room and, mainly, to preserve the

olive trees present on the ground;

other olive trees are moved on

the rooftops, reaching this way

the aim to save almost all the existing

olives.

The rooftops are meant as roof

gardens, allowing the impression

to live the house such a natural

continuation of landscape, which

means to imagine an urban development

that doesn’t change in

any way the context.
